Medical Assistants are valuable members of a healthcare team. These healthcare professionals are responsible for both administrative and clinical tasks in the offices of physicians, hospitals, and other healthcare facilities. Medical Assistants perform an assortment of duties, including routine tasks and procedures such as measuring patients’ vital signs, administering medications and injections, and recording information in medical recordkeeping systems. Administrative duties include greeting patients, updating and filing patients’ medical records, and scheduling appointments. Medical Assistants also act as a patient coordinator by providing a means of communication between patients, doctors and other health care providers.

Optical/Optometric Assistants are specially trained medical assistants responsible for supporting the Optometrist (Eye Doctor) and assisting the patients themselves directly. Optical/Optometric Assistants have both technical duties, including administering eye exams, preparing exam rooms, and fitting patients with the appropriate eyewear; and administrative duties, including answering phones, greeting patients, and scheduling exams.

Medical Laboratory Assistants are responsible for duties including performing routine and specialized tests, recording testing information, and preparing specimens. Lab assistants may also be responsible for cleaning and restocking the lab facility, keeping inventory, and ordering lab supplies. EKG technicians specialize in electrocardiogram (EKG) testing for patients. EKG machines are complex devices that monitor the heart’s performance through wires and electrodes attached to a patient’s chest, arms and legs. Phlebotomists are the health care professionals who draw blood, ensuring that the proper amount is taken and that all blood is properly labeled. Their main responsibility is drawing and preparing blood for lab testing, but Phlebotomists are also responsible for collecting specimens of other bodily fluids for testing as well.
